Significance of preoperative exercise oxygen desaturation in lung cancer with interstitial lung disease

Abstract

Abstract OBJECTIVES Evaluating the diffusing capacity for carbon monoxide (DLco) is crucial for patients with lung cancer and interstitial lung disease. However, the clinical significance of assessing exercise oxygen desaturation (EOD) remains unclear. METHODS We retrospectively analysed 186 consecutive patients with interstitial lung disease who underwent lobectomy for non-small-cell lung cancer. EOD was assessed using the two-flight test (TFT), with TFT positivity defined as ≥5% SpO2 reduction. We investigated the impact of EOD and predicted postoperative (ppo)%DLco on postoperative complications and prognosis. RESULTS A total of 106 (57%) patients were identified as TFT-positive, and 58 (31%) patients had ppo% DLco 30%. Pulmonary complications were significantly more prevalent in TFT-positive patients than in TFT-negative patients (52% vs 19%, P 0.001), and multivariable analysis revealed that TFT-positivity was an independent risk factor (odds ratio 3.46, 95% confidence interval 1.70–7.07, P 0.001), whereas ppo%DLco was not (P = 0.09). In terms of long-term outcomes, both TFT positivity and ppo%DLco 30% independently predicted overall survival. We divided the patients into 4 groups based on TFT positivity and ppo%DLco status. TFT-positive patients with ppo%DLco 30% exhibited the significantly lowest 5-year overall survival among the 4 groups: ppo%DLco ≥ 30% and TFT-negative, 54.2%; ppo%DLco 30% and TFT-negative, 68.8%; ppo%DLco ≥ 30% and TFT-positive, 38.1%; and ppo%DLco 30% and TFT-positive, 16.7% (P = 0.001). CONCLUSIONS Incorporating EOD evaluation was useful for predicting postoperative complications and survival outcomes in patients with lung cancer and interstitial lung disease.
